The art of the photomontage came of age in Russia in the decades following the October Revolution. Its key proponent was Gustav Klutsis, who was not only a pioneer, but also quickly became the undisputed master of the genre. The visual language of the photomontage was so appealing to the Soviet leaders that it fast became the preferred method of dispersing pictorial propaganda. Unable to keep up with the demand, a host of other talented artists followed in Klutsis's footsteps, churning out images to help promote all aspects of the Communist State. Some of these artists left prominent works behind them, while others labored in virtual anonymity. In either case the resulting posters are excellent documents of a entirely bygone social, political and artistic system.
